Jobs for Computer Science Grads in California
In this state, there are 643,340 people employed in jobs related to a CompSci degree, compared to 3,938,530 nationwide.
Wages for Computer Science Jobs in California
A typical salary for a CompSci grad in the state is $174,445, compared to a typical salary of $139,167 nationwide.

Computer Science Careers in CA
Some of the careers CompSci majors go into include:
| Job Title | Nationwide Job Growth | Nationwide Median Salary |
|---|---|---|
| Software Developers | 14% | $76,447 |
| Web and Digital Interface Designers | 13% | $88,198 |
| Information Security Analysts | 12% | $111,930 |
| Computer Programmers | 12% | $109,892 |
| Computer and Information Systems Managers | 10% | $175,079 |
| Computer and Information Research Scientists | 8% | $61,002 |
| Data Scientists | 8% | $106,295 |
| Penetration Testers | 7% | $93,800 |
| Blockchain Engineers | 5% | $123,667 |
| Web Developers | 5% | $125,527 |
| Database Architects | 4% | $148,480 |
| Data Warehousing Specialists | 4% | $117,424 |
